Solve the problem. Round the point estimate to the nearest thousandth. Find the point estimate of the proportion of people who w
Blababa [14]

Answer:

b. 0.055

Step-by-step explanation:

The point estimate of the proportion of people who wear hearing aids is

The number of people in the sample who wear hearing aids divided by the total number of people in the sample.

In this problem, we have that:

Sample of 855.

47 people in the sample had hearing aids.

47/855 = 0.0549

Rounding up

0.055

So the correct answer is:

b. 0.055
